Elizabeth "Sharon" Anne Manning Chadwell

September 1, 1943 — June 5, 2023

Knoxville

Elizabeth Sharon Anne Manning Chadwell, age 79, of Knoxville, passed away Monday, June 5, 2023 at her home surrounded by her loving family.

She was born on September 1, 1943 at Evans Hospital in Middlesboro, Kentucky to the proud parents Charlie and Agnes Brooks Manning. Sharon grew up on a hillside farm, building character by cutting iron weeds and blackberry briars. She met her sweetheart in high school. Secretly eloping a few years later to marry; they have been happily married for 58 years. Throughout her adult life, Sharon taught 26 years; starting out as a history teacher at Rule High School, but the majority of her career and influence was spent as a kindergarten teacher in Tellico Plains. She has impacted over 750 plus young lives. She was a loving mother and grandmother, who always made time when she saw a need. She will be missed!
